Solution Overview

Problem

Existing technologies face challenges in generating customized digital components that accurately reflect the context of user queries, requiring substantial storage and bandwidth to manage various contextual environments.

Innovation Solution

The use of artificial intelligence (AI) systems that receive user queries, select digital components, and interact with machine learning models to edit images based on digital component data and query data, generating customized digital components that align with user intent and contextual data.

Data Source

PatentUS20250078361A1Using generative artificial intelligence to edit images based on contextual data
Publication Date: 2025.03.06 GOOGLE LLC

AI summary

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for enabling artificial intelligence to generate new images based on contextual data and to generate digital components based on the images. In one aspect, a method includes receiving one or more queries from a client device of a user. A digital component is selected based on the one or more queries. A customized digital component is generated by obtaining an image of an object corresponding to the selected digital component and generating, using a language model, an image editing prompt for editing the image based on digital component data related to the digital component and query data including the one or more queries and contextual data. The image and the image editing prompt are provided to an image editing model. An edited image is received and used to generate the customized digital component.
